Job Brief
As an Abstract Writer, you will play a crucial role in researching and summarizing real estate records and legal documents. Your primary responsibilities will include examining titles, compiling lists of mortgages and contracts, and ensuring accurate documentation for various stakeholders, including law firms, real estate agencies, and title insurance companies. The ideal candidate will possess str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a solid understanding of property law and title examination.
Responsibilities
- Conduct thorough searches of public and private real estate records to gather relevant information.
- Examine and analyze property titles to ensure accuracy and compliance with legal standards.
- Summarize legal and insurance documents, highlighting essential details for various purposes.
- Compile and maintain organized lists of mortgages, contracts, and other instruments related to titles.
- Collaborate with legal teams, real estate professionals, and title insurance companies to facilitate transactions.
- Provide expert recommendations based on findings to support decision-making processes.
- Stay updated on industry trends, regulations, and best practices related to real estate and title writing.
